之前已经在TensorRT7.2.1下将模型转换为trt格式的文件,现在一台新服务器上使用tensorrt8.0.1的容器部署,同样是T4显卡下,出现下面的问题:

This container was built for NVIDIA Driver Release 470.42 or later, but version 460.91.03 was detected and compatibility mode is UNAVAILABLE.

查询了tensorrt8.0.1容器的官方文档 ,有下面一行:

Release 21.07 is based on NVIDIA CUDA 11.4.0, which requires NVIDIA Driver release 470 or later.  However, if you are running on Data Center GPUs (formerly Tesla), for example, T4, you may use NVIDIA driver release 418.40 (or later R418), 440.33 (or later R440), 450.51 (or later R450), or 460.27 (or later R460).

地址:

https://docs.nvidia.com/deeplearning/tensorrt/container-release-notes/rel_21-07.html#rel_21-07

说明是driver版本不匹配。

解决方法

1、在tensorrt8.0.1容器里重新将模型转换为trt模型,模型可以转换成功,运行时也没有报错,但是推理结果不正确(一定要核对推理结果是否正确),说明该方法不可行。

2、在新服务器上重新安装tensorrt7.2.1容器,在里面进行推理,结果正确,此方法成功解决。

方法总结

tensorrt版本的NVIDIA Driver需求要与服务器的NVIDIA Driver相匹配,不然即使转换成功,也会导致推理的结果不正确。我服务器的NVIDIA Driver版本为460.91.03,官方文档上tensorrt7.2.1的要求是

Release 20.11 is based on NVIDIA CUDA 11.1.0, which requires NVIDIA Driver release 455 or later.

所以能正确推理出结果。

总结原因,没有认真了解tensorrt版本与NVIDIA Driver版本的匹配性,导致部署时走了弯路。

TensorRT 推理时提示This container was built for NVIDIA Driver Release 470.42 or later 解决方法相关推荐

  1. 在安装project2010 64位时提示 “无法安装64位office,因为已有32位版本”解决方法

    在安装project2010 64位时提示 "无法安装64位office,因为已有32位版本"解决方法 参考文章: (1)在安装project2010 64位时提示 "无 ...

  2. [UE4]打包运行时提示Plugin ‘‘ failed to load because module ‘‘ could not be found.缺少插件解决方法

    提示错误如下 Plugin 'Dialoqueplugin' failed to load because module 'DialoguePlugin' could not be found. Pl ...

  3. Flutter开发:运行项目时提示Error parsing LocalFile:‘/Users/xxx/android/app/src/main/AndroidManifest.xml’…解决方法

    前言 在Flutter开发初期的时候,会遇到各种各样的问题,这个时候对于刚接触Flutter开发的开发者来说是有点费事费力的,所以在Flutter开发初期要多积累,多查阅,多踩坑,这样才能快速上手开发 ...

  4. Idea运行web项目时,提示java.lang.ClassNotFoundException: com.mysql.jdbc.Driver解决方法

    Idea运行web项目时,提示java.lang.ClassNotFoundException: com.mysql.jdbc.Driver解决方法 参考文章: (1)Idea运行web项目时,提示j ...

  5. win2000启动时提示“无法定位程序输入点SaferCreateLevel于动态链接库ADVAPI32.dll上”怎么解决?

    win2000启动时提示"无法定位程序输入点SaferCreateLevel于动态链接库ADVAPI32.dll上"怎么解决?谢谢 悬赏分:5 - 解决时间:2006-5-10 2 ...

  6. 解决安装黑苹果出现提示应用程序副本已损坏,不能用来安装macOS的解决方法

    安装黑苹果系统出现提示 应用程序副本已损坏,不能用来安装macOS的解决方法 不管是实体机黑苹果安装,还是虚拟机安装,都会遇得到 原因,苹果系统镜像文件中内置的时间证书到期 比如现在的时间是2019/ ...

  7. 提示“正尝试安装的adobe flash player不是最新版本”的解决方法

    在安装flash player 10时遇到提示"正尝试安装的adobe flash player不是最新版本"的解决方法: 执行 regedit,找到以下位置:[HKEY_LOCA ...

  8. 安装黑苹果提示未能安装_解决安装黑苹果出现提示应用程序副本已损坏,不能用来安装macOS的解决方法...

    安装黑苹果系统出现提示 应用程序副本已损坏,不能用来安装macOS的解决方法 不管是实体机黑苹果安装,还是虚拟机安装,都会遇得到 原因,苹果系统镜像文件中内置的时间证书到期 比如现在的时间是2019/ ...

  9. 未受用户在此计算机上的请求登陆,win7系统访问网上邻居提示未授予用户在此计算机上的请求登录类型的解决方法...

    今天和大家分享一下win7系统访问网上邻居提示未授予用户在此计算机上的请求登录类型问题的解决方法,在使用win7系统的过程中经常不知道如何去解决win7系统访问网上邻居提示未授予用户在此计算机上的请求 ...

最新文章

  1. 如何查看,当运行一个hibernate 方法后到底执行了哪些SQL语句
  2. 从终端命令行运行 AppleScript 脚本
  3. Netty对Protocol Buffer多协议的支持(八)
  4. python报表_Python生成报表
  5. CSS Grid中的陷阱和绊脚石
  6. python:将数据写入csv文件
  7. java jpa 教程 查询_Spring Boot JPA 使用教程
  8. Linux--rpm、yum等安装软件
  9. 英语问题,(有些答案不对,不对的请说一声)
  10. ❤️爆肝十二万字《python从零到精通教程》,从零教你变大佬❤️(建议收藏)
  11. Arm开发板上使用ldd命令
  12. Vscode 配置默认浏览器打开
  13. Win10系统自带的备份,恢复功能
  14. postgresql集群方案hot standby初级测试(四)——xlog详细解释header
  15. SIM900A发送数据到新浪云服务器
  16. 货币银行学简答论述题
  17. Keep熬过冬天,但互联网健身的生意依然不好做
  18. win10添加自定义右键菜单
  19. 《深入理解JAVA虚拟机》周志明 第三版 - 第二章 JAVA内存区域与内存溢出异常
  20. 为什么maven没有3.7的版本

热门文章

  1. 作为维基百科全书的系统、全球最著名的wiki程序——MediaWiki
  2. IBHLink S7++ 模块 AEG 调功器 Thyro-S 1S 400-100 HRL1
  3. x264 代码重点详解 详细分析
  4. 通过网络地址下载图片示例
  5. 我的物联网项目(十五) 微服务业务拆分
  6. 【田园原木风格装修案例】清新自然的原木风
  7. android 滑轮,android 滑轮多选
  8. 计算机考研英语自我介绍范文,研究生考研英语面试自我介绍范文(精选4篇)...
  9. 附近的人打招呼V1.0
  10. 12-属性动画源码分析